Small compact versatile bottlebrush to under 1m with scarlet red flowers that give a spectacular massed display of colour. Very hardy low hedge.
APPEARANCE: A dwarf, evergreen shrub which, in spring, is covered with bright red, bottle brush flowers that are attractive to birds.
USE IN: Ideal for creating a low hedge, for rockeries and large tubs.
LOCATION: Very hardy and forgiving in all types of soil. Prefers full sun but will tolerate dappled shade.
CARE: Mulch and water regularly until the plant is established, usually around 12 weeks. Prune tips while young to encourage dense growth and fertilise with a slow release native fertiliser in spring.
HEIGHT & WIDTH: 1m H x 1m W.
